the coin is flipped one more time. a tree diagram has been started for you to represent the possible outcomes. determine the results from another coin flip. what is the probability that the coin lands heads up all three times? 1/8 1/4 1/3 1/2
Answer
Explanation:
Step1: Determine probability of single - flip
The probability of getting heads in a single fair coin - flip is $\frac{1}{2}$.
Step2: Use multiplication rule for independent events
Since coin flips are independent events, for 3 flips, the probability of getting heads each time is $P(HHH)=\frac{1}{2}\times\frac{1}{2}\times\frac{1}{2}$.
Step3: Calculate the result
$\frac{1}{2}\times\frac{1}{2}\times\frac{1}{2}=\frac{1}{8}$.
Answer:
$\frac{1}{8}$
